I took the opportunity at Monk’s to have something a bit less heavy with dinner, so opted for this, mainly because I hadn’t seen it before in the UK. Pours a very dark brown with a thin head. Nose is malty and a little bit sour, but not as malty as the colour conjured in my head. Almost mild maltiness. Some fruitiness here, but a bit thin. Mouthfeel is a little bit fizzy, and a bit drying, but light on the palate. Quite good.

Bottle conditioned. Dark brown with no head. Aromas are earthy malts, smoky with chocolate and some herbal notes. Flavours are chocolate malts with some citrus tang. Quite herbal and floral with resinous fruitiness and hints of metal towards the finish. Dark chocolate bitterness on the aftertaste. a cross between and old ale and a porter. Pretty good.
